How much does it cost to rent a home in Manchester?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Manchester 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,112 | $2,375 | $3,975 |
| Manchester 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,521 | $2,850 | $10,000+ |
| Manchester 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,206 | $2,950 | $10,000+ |
| Manchester 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,950 | $3,950 | $3,950 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Manchester
What type of rentals are currently available in Manchester?
There are currently 75 Apartments for Rent in Manchester, MA with pricing that ranges from $1,450 to $4,750. There are also 35 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Manchester ranging from $2,300 to $12,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Manchester?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Manchester ranges from $2,300 to $12,500 with an average monthly rent of $4,550.
